All changes to the LapTrace timing-chip reader firmware require two approvals before merge. The first comes from any member of the Fieldware team and covers code quality and test coverage, including the simulated-race harness. The second is a domain approval confirming that timing accuracy stays within the two-millisecond tolerance defined in the Bramleigh certification spec. Changes touching the antenna driver additionally need a hardware review. Reviewers should reject any change lacking a rollback note. Final domain approval rests with:

account owner for bawip-tahag: Raleth Quenok

Leadership Review Briefing — Northvale Expansion

For the incoming director: Arclight Provisions intends to enter the Northvale region within two quarters. Two warehouse sites shortlisted; lease terms under negotiation. Local hiring plan drafted, pending budget sign-off. Main risks: regulatory licensing timelines and an entrenched competitor, Dunmoor Supply. Marketing launch scoped but unfunded. Decision required on phased versus full entry at the review session. The confidential strategic note is set out immediately below.

board note of baweg-bawig: Project Tamath slips by six weeks because of the audit delay.

### Action Item 4: Publish fan-out backpressure limits (Hollybrook incident)

Plugin authors pushing notifications through the Murmur fan-out bus must respect the host's backpressure signals rather than buffering unboundedly, which is what amplified the Hollybrook outage. Going forward, the bus will reject batches exceeding the published ceilings and emit a `throttle` event plugins must handle. The enforced constants, effective next release, are listed below.

tuning constants:
QUOTAS = {
    "druwyn": 5,
    "holix": 5,
    "zorath": 5,
    "holwyn": 10,
}